Mediator in Chief: How Qatar's Role Remains Crucial to Gaza Ceasefire Holding

As the world watches on whether the Gaza ceasefire will hold, Qatar's involvement remains fundamentally crucial. This wealthy Gulf nation serves as a key guaranteeing entity supporting the precarious peace.

Intricate Double Function

More than perhaps any other nation, the Gulf state wields considerable sway regarding Hamas's coming choices. This stems from its intricate double role serving as both Israel-sanctioned negotiator and a unilateral conduit for humanitarian support and cash for Gaza-based Hamas.

Over the past decade, Doha has provided residence for Hamas's political leadership within its capital city.

Position Changes

Via approving the New York statement during the summer, Doha accepted principally to Hamas ending its governance in Gaza and transferring its arms to the PA.

This stance brought Qatar's perspective nearer to the stances of the Saudi kingdom and the UAE.

Political Solution

The era of opposition has currently ended. The Israeli leader was forced to express regret to Doha representatives according to exact guidelines mutually established by Washington and Doha leadership.

A formal trilateral mechanism between Israel, Qatar, and the US was established to improve shared safety and avoid coming misperceptions.

Defense Measures

Afterward, the American leader approved a presidential directive providing security protection to the Gulf state.

The Pentagon agreed to permit Gulf state jets to conduct missions from an American air force base.

Immediate Challenges

Doha encounters two primary challenges in the short term.

  • Initially, the nation will need utilize its significant knowledge in brokering with the organization to convince the movement to surrender weapons entirely.
  • Furthermore, the Gulf state might redirect attention to the PA leadership and committed changes while avoiding earlier unofficial agreements that showed complications.

This complex process will require detailed negotiations encompassing various elements from weapon types to tunnel networks and conceivable resettlement plans for high-level Hamas members.

Prospective Courses

Considering the massive devastation in Gaza and global scrutiny concerning Qatar's peacemaking attempts, the Gulf state favors more formal multilateral mechanisms while the truce advances beyond its initial phase.

The nation seeks diminished unofficial communications and grown clear mechanisms to secure enduring calm in the troubled region.
